North Sikkim tour package Lachen Lachung Yumthag Valley and Gurudongmar Lake is included in the package.North Sikkim is a popular tourist destination in the northeastern part of India. It is known for its breathtaking natural beauty, serene landscapes, and rich cultural heritage. Here are some key points about North Sikkim tourism Pristine Beauty North Sikkim is renowned for its untouched beauty and picturesque landscapes. The region is home to snow-capped mountains, alpine meadows, dense forests, and glistening lakes. The views of the Himalayas from North Sikkim are awe-inspiring, attracting nature lovers and adventure enthusiasts. Remote Villages: North Sikkim offers the opportunity to visit remote villages and experience the unique local culture and traditions. Villages like Lachen, Lachung, and Chungthang provide a glimpse into the traditional lifestyle of the Sikkimese people. Homestays are available in some villages, allowing tourists to immerse themselves in the local way of life. High-Altitude Lakes: The region is home to several stunning high-altitude lakes that add to its charm. The famous Gurudongmar Lake,Tsomgo Lake, and Chopta Valley are some of the must-visit lakes in North Sikkim. These lakes are known for their pristine blue waters, surrounded by snow-capped peaks. Adventure Activities: North Sikkim offers a range of adventure activities for thrill-seekers. Trekking is a popular activity, with options like the Dzongri-Goechala Trek and the Green Lake Trek. White-water rafting in the Teesta River and mountain biking are also available for those seeking an adrenaline rush. Monasteries and Culture: The region is dotted with monasteries that are important cultural and religious landmarks. The Phodong Monastery, Lachen Monastery, and Lachung Monastery are notable ones worth exploring. These monasteries provide a glimpse into the Buddhist heritage of the region. Flowering Season: North Sikkim is famous for its vibrant flowering season, particularly in the Yumthang Valley. During spring (March to May), the valley blooms with a variety of alpine flowers, including numerous species of rhododendrons, creating a breathtaking carpet of colors. Restricted Area It's important to note that certain areas of North Sikkim require permits and are restricted to tourists. Permits can be obtained from the authorities in Gangtok or through authorized tour operators. When planning a visit to North Sikkim, it is advisable to check the weather conditions and road accessibility, as the region experiences harsh winters and the roads may be affected during heavy rainfall. Hiring a local guide or tour operator is recommended to ensure a smooth and enjoyable trip.

DAY 3 : GANGTOK TO LACHEN EXCURSION

Travel to Lachen Seven Sister Water Falls Road Trip Sightseeing Other Benefits (On Arrival) Breakfast Dinner Cab Transfer The third day of your thrilling Sikkim holiday tour with friends invite you to explore the unspoilt town of Lachen. Post breakfast, check-out from the hotel and get ready for an exhilarating trip to Lachen with your gang. Enroute visit the picturesque Singhik View Point. The next attraction that you will visit on your North East holiday to Lachen will be the Seven Sister Water Falls. Also, visit the Chungthang confluence on your Sikkim holiday tour where the Teesta River meets with the gushing Lachung River and the Lachen River, casting a spell over you. Upon reaching this remote town, check-in at the hotel and de-stress for a while. Chill out with friends exploring this mesmerising town thoroughly. Enjoy your comfortable overnight stay at the hotel. Distance from Gangtok to Lachen: 108 km Travel Time (Gangtok to Lachen): Approx 4 hours The Seven sisters waterfall in the North east is a must see attraction The gorgeous Teesta River in Sikkim Enjoy the beautiful views of the Himalayas .


DAY 4 : LACHEN TO LACHUNG EXCURSION

Transfer from Lachen to Lachung Gurudongmar Lake Chopta Valley Thangu Village Other Benefits (On Arrival) Breakfast Dinner Cab Transfer Head out for a fun-filled excursion to Thangu, Chopta Valley & Gurudongmar Lake on this day of your North East holiday. After a nutritious breakfast, complete the check-out formalities and head out for an adventurous journey to Lachung. On the way visit the nomadic village of Thangu, famous for the traditional wooden houses built on the alpine meadows and Teesta River flowing through the lush valley. Next up on your trip to Lachung is the unexplored Chopta Valley. A heaven for the adventure seekers, the place is dotted with scenic landscapes draped in the snow on one side and the emerald green pine forests and the meandering rivers on the other side. The last destination on your Sikkim tour itinerary would be the milky Gurudongmar Lake that offers stunning Himalayan views. Come back to the Lachung for a scrumptious lunch. Mark an end to the fourth day of North East tour package itinerary with an overnight stay at Lachung. Distance from Lachen to Lachung: 47 km Travel Time (Lachen to Lachung): 1.5 hours The town of Lachung in North Sikkim The majestic hilly roads leading to Chopta Valley Visit the Thangu Village in Sikkim.
